对数据进行类型转换等处理:df4= df.copy() #18 复制一份数据,保护原数据 df4['新列']=df4['...
然后我们将这个对象放入一个数组中。现在,我们将使用 pandas 和该数组创建一个数据框,然后使用该数据框...
import pandas as pd# 常见的日期+时间的表示方法pd_time = pd.to_datetime("2023-08-29 17:17:22")print(type(pd_time),pd_time)# 时间简写,并用12小时制的表示方法pd_time1 = pd.to_datetime("2023-08-29 5:17pm")print(type(pd_time1), pd_time1)# / 表示法pd_time2 = pd.to_datetime...
相关问答FAQs:1. Python/Pandas如何处理大规模的数据? 处理大规模数据的关键在于使用内存高效的数据结构和算法。对于百亿行,数十列的数据,可以考虑使用Pandas的内存映射(Memory Mapping)功能,以避免将整个数据集加载到内存中。也可以利用Pandas的分块读取功能,逐块处理数据,避免一次性读取整个大型数据集。
并行处理是提升数据处理速度的有效方式。利用Python的并行处理库如concurrent.futures或multiprocessing,我们可以将任务分发到多个核心,实现并行处理。在Pandas中,例如,在进行数据清洗或特征计算时,可以将DataFrame切分成块,然后并行应用函数。然而,并行化需要注意计算的瓶颈,如I/O限制和内存限制,并确保正确地管理进程间通讯。
1、导入pandas库 import pandas as pd 2、读取CSV文件 data = pd.read_csv('file.csv') 3、读取Excel文件 data = pd.read_excel('file.xlsx') 4、读取JSON文件 data = pd.read_json('file.json') 5、显示前5行数据 print(data.head())
Python是一种高级编程语言,而pandas是Python中一个强大的数据处理库。pandas提供了高效的数据结构和数据分析工具,使得数据处理变得简单且高效。 使用Python以内存高效的方式使用pandas处理数据,可以通过以下步骤实现: 导入pandas库:首先需要导入pandas库,可以使用以下代码实现: 代码语言:txt 复制 import pandas as pd...
【Python基础】如何用Pandas处理文本数据? 文本数据是指不能参与算术运算的任何字符,也称为字符型数据。如英文字母、汉字、不作为数值使用的数字(以单引号开头)和其他可输入的字符。文本数据具有数据维度高、数据量大且语义复杂等特点,是一种较为复杂的数据类型。今天,我们就来一起看看如何使用Pandas对文本数据进行...
ps:pandas中是默认nan安全的。 补充:Python 处理DataFrame数据 pd.isnull() np.isnan()的方式 数据处理时,经常会遇到处理数据中的空值,涉及几个常用函数,pd.isnull(),pd.notnull(),np.isnan(),pd.notna(),pd.isna(),pd.fillna()、pd.dropna()等等. ...
答案:使用Python中的pandas库可以进行数据清洗和预处理。以下是一些常见的操作:使用read_csv()函数读取数据,使用drop()函数删除不需要的列或行,使用fillna()函数填充缺失值,使用replace()函数替换值,使用astype()函数转换数据类型,使用merge()函数合并数据集等。此外,还可以使用其他库如numpy和matplotlib来辅助进行数据...